Applying lean quality with risk analysis to aid shipyard block assembly decision making

The continually ephemeral demands of the shipbuilding market has forced shipyard management to be ready for change in order to maintain competitiveness. Applying principles of lean manufacturing in various degrees has proven to produce positive results in many industries including the shipbuilding industry. The concept of lean quality stresses the importance of quality which is one of the pillars and principles of lean manufacturing. The panel-block assembly line is a key production area where applying the lean quality concept can ease the decision making process for shipyard management with regards to changes in production. This includes analyzing various methods of block assembly in order to determine which method is best for the present state of shipyard technology and which method should eventually be chosen for the future. This paper shows that improving the methodology of the panel-block assembly line process alone will not yield better production results. Methodology must be in par with technology in order to bring about improvements. Finally, a Monte Carlo risk analysis clearly illustrates the results of the methods and allows shipyard management the ability to make decisions which have minimal risk both in the present and in the future.
